Lupe Fiasco honored in GQ magazine

Published: Nov. 22, 2006 at 2:39 PM

LOS ANGELES, Nov. 22 (UPI) -- Atlantic Records recording artist Lupe Fiasco has been named one of GQ Magazine's "Men of the Year 2006."

He has received the "Breakout" honors on the annual ranking, reported Atlantic Records in a news release.

The rapper joins star icons, Leonardo DiCaprio, Jay-Z, Will Ferrell, Al Gore and the cast of "Jackass" on the list.

Fiasco will appear on the "Late Show with David Letterman" to celebrate the GQ award. He will perform his new single, "Daydreamin'," accompanied by Jill Scott, who is featured on the track.
